GARY NIBLETT
Gary NiblettGary Niblett's art is a celebration of life, capturing the simple beauty found in the everyday moment. His work portrays the quiet fortitude that tamed the Western Frontier, Reminding the viewer that it is in the aftermath rather than the storm that strength of character is often found.

Having been born and raised in the small town of Carlsbad, New Mexico, this affection for the less complicated life is the fiber of Niblett's being. Although he began his career as a commercial illustrator, Western Art has always been his first love, and dedication to accurately portraying this way of life won him a coveted membership in the prestigious Cowboy Artists of America in 1975. Since then, his work has recieved both national and international acclaim.


Gary's paintings have been exhibited at the Royal Watercolor Society, in London, England, The Grand Palais in Paris, France, The Amerika Haus in Berlin, Germany and the major exhibit halls of Russia and China.
